    Unveiling the Beauty of Andaman and Nicobar Islands

    First off, Andaman and Nicobar Islands are an archipelago located in the Bay of Bengal. They're composed of hundreds of islands, but only a handful are inhabited. The islands are divided into two main groups: the Andaman Islands to the north and the Nicobar Islands to the south. Each group boasts its own unique charm and attractions.     Top Things to Do in Andaman and Nicobar Islands

    Alright, let's get into the fun stuff! What can you actually do in the Andaman and Nicobar Islands? The list is long, so get ready to start planning your itinerary! First on the list is snorkeling and diving. The Andaman and Nicobar Islands are renowned as one of the best diving destinations in the world. The crystal-clear waters are home to a vibrant ecosystem, with colorful coral reefs and an abundance of marine life. Head to Havelock Island for some of the best diving and snorkeling spots. Experienced divers can explore deeper waters and discover shipwrecks, while beginners can enjoy guided snorkeling tours. Next up is exploring the beaches. Of course! The Andaman and Nicobar Islands are famous for their stunning beaches. Radhanagar Beach on Havelock Island consistently ranks among the best beaches in the world, with its pristine white sand and turquoise waters. Other must-visit beaches include Elephant Beach, also on Havelock Island, and Bharatpur Beach on Neil Island. You can soak up the sun, swim, or simply relax and enjoy the breathtaking views. For the adventure junkies, try some water sports. Andaman and Nicobar Islands offer a plethora of water sports activities, including jet skiing, parasailing, and sea walking. You can also try kayaking through the mangroves or go on a glass-bottom boat ride to get a glimpse of the underwater world. Remember to prioritize safety and choose reputable operators for these activities. The islands also offer a chance to explore the historical sites. Port Blair, the capital of Andaman and Nicobar Islands, is home to Cellular Jail, a colonial-era prison that holds significant historical importance. Take a guided tour to learn about the history of the freedom fighters who were imprisoned here. Sound and light shows are held in the evening, providing a moving tribute. For those who want to be immersed in the natural beauty, explore the rainforests. Trekking through the lush rainforests is another exciting experience. The islands are home to several national parks and sanctuaries, where you can spot exotic birds, animals, and plants. Hiking trails of varying difficulty levels are available, so you can choose one that suits your fitness level. Remember to carry essentials like water, sunscreen, and insect repellent. These islands also offer an opportunity for island hopping. With so many islands to explore, island hopping is a must-do activity. You can take ferries or speedboats to visit different islands and discover their unique charms. Each island has its own distinct character, so you'll experience a lot of variety. Neil Island, for instance, is known for its laid-back atmosphere and beautiful sunsets. Lastly, don't forget to indulge in local cuisine. The cuisine of the Andaman and Nicobar Islands is a delightful fusion of Indian, Burmese, and Thai influences, featuring fresh seafood and tropical flavors. Try local delicacies like fish curry, grilled seafood, and coconut-based dishes. Also, sample fresh fruits and juices for a refreshing treat.     Must-See Destinations in Andaman and Nicobar Islands

    Okay, so where exactly should you go? Let's break down some of the must-see destinations in the Andaman and Nicobar Islands. Havelock Island tops the list. This is the most popular island, and for good reason! Home to the iconic Radhanagar Beach, Havelock Island offers a wide range of activities and attractions. You can enjoy water sports, explore the beaches, or simply relax and soak in the natural beauty. With its crystal-clear waters and vibrant marine life, Havelock Island is a paradise for divers and snorkelers. Next is Neil Island. This is a more tranquil island, perfect for those seeking a laid-back vacation. It's known for its beautiful sunsets, serene beaches, and lush greenery. Enjoy a leisurely stroll along the beaches or explore the local villages. You can also try scuba diving or snorkeling in the clear waters. Then, we have Port Blair. As the capital, Port Blair is the gateway to the Andaman and Nicobar Islands. It offers a blend of historical sites and natural attractions. Visit Cellular Jail to learn about the colonial past. Take a boat trip to Ross Island, which was once the administrative headquarters during the British rule. Enjoy the beautiful sunsets at Corbyn's Cove Beach. For a touch of history, check out Cellular Jail. This is a must-visit for anyone interested in the history of India's independence movement. This infamous jail served as a place of exile for political prisoners during British rule. You can take a guided tour to learn about the jail's history and the struggles of the freedom fighters. The light and sound show in the evening is a moving experience. Then, there is Ross Island. This island was once the administrative headquarters during the British rule. You can explore the ruins of colonial buildings, including churches, hospitals, and administrative offices. The island offers a glimpse into the colonial past, surrounded by lush greenery. It's a great spot for taking photos. You can also visit Baratang Island. It's known for its limestone caves and mud volcanoes. Take a boat trip through the mangrove creeks to reach the limestone caves and witness the unique geological formations. The mud volcanoes offer a fascinating natural phenomenon.     Travel Tips for Your Andaman and Nicobar Adventure

    Alright, let's talk practicalities. Here are some travel tips to help you plan your trip to the Andaman and Nicobar Islands smoothly. First up, the best time to visit. The ideal time to visit the Andaman and Nicobar Islands is from October to May. The weather is generally pleasant during this period, with clear skies and calm seas. The monsoon season, from June to September, brings heavy rainfall and rough seas, which may impact your travel plans. Then you need to think about transportation. The primary means of transportation between the islands is by ferry or speedboat. Government ferries are more affordable, while private speedboats are faster. You can also hire taxis or rent scooters on some of the islands. For getting around the islands, you can consider using local buses. They are an economical option, especially for exploring Port Blair and other islands. Keep in mind that the availability of transport may vary, so plan accordingly. Next up, you need to think about accommodation. The Andaman and Nicobar Islands offer a wide range of accommodation options. From budget-friendly guesthouses to luxury resorts, there is something for every budget and preference. It is recommended to book your accommodation in advance, especially during peak season, to secure your preferred choice. Also, remember to get the necessary permits. Indian citizens do not require any permits to visit the Andaman and Nicobar Islands. However, if you are a foreign national, you will need a Restricted Area Permit (RAP). This permit can be obtained on arrival at the Port Blair airport or by applying in advance through the Indian Embassy or Consulate. When visiting the islands, be sure to respect the local culture and environment. Dress modestly when visiting religious sites, and avoid littering or damaging the coral reefs. Support local businesses and engage with the local communities. And finally, pack accordingly. Pack light, comfortable clothing, swimwear, sunscreen, insect repellent, and any necessary medications. Don't forget to bring a waterproof bag or cover to protect your valuables from water. Also, pack a universal adapter if your electronic devices use different plugs.
